抗家鼠型HFRS病毒McAb 13E_2V_H基因的克隆及序列分析

Cloning and Sequencing of the V_H Gene From 13E_2 McAb against House-Rat Type of HFRS Virus

摘要 从分泌高亲和力抗家鼠型HFRS病毒型特异性McAb的杂交瘤细胞系13E2中提取细胞总RNA,经逆转录合成CDNA,并以之为模板,用特异性引物进行PCR,扩增出约360bp产物,将之克隆入PUC18质粒中。序列分析表明,所克隆的基因符合编码小鼠抗体VH的特征。13E2VH基因由266个bp组成,编码122个氨基酸,隶属于小鼠重链ⅡA亚组。 RNA extracted from hybridoma cell 13E2 secreting specific McAb against house-rat type ofHFRS virus was transcripted reversely into cDNA with oligo(dT)15 primers.The first strand cDNAwas used as template for PCR to amplify 13E2 VH gene. 13E2VH gene was isolated and cloned intoPUC18 vectors. The VH gene inserted into plasmid PUC18 was sequenced by Sanger's dideoxy-mediatedchain-termination method. It was shown that 13E2VH gene consisted of 366 bp and was derived possibly from group Ⅱ A of the mouse heavy chain.
